The size of Edensor Park is approximately 3.1 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 14.8% of total area. The population of Edensor Park in 2016 was 9772 people. By 2021 the population was 10279 showing a population growth of 5.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Edensor Park is 50-59 years. Households in Edensor Park are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Edensor Park work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 71.10% of the homes in Edensor Park were owner-occupied compared with 74.50% in 2016.
